IWO Hedge Fund Activity: Q3 2017 in Review

477 of the 4,011 institutional investors tracked by Wall St. Rank reported a position in iShares Russell 2000 Growth ETF (IWO) for Q3 2017, worth a combined $5.51B — up 8.4% from $5.09B a quarter earlier.

Buyers outnumbered sellers: 45 funds opened new IWO positions and 37 closed out — a net gain of 8 holders — while 154 added to existing stakes and 154 trimmed.

The largest buyer was Morgan Stanley, adding an estimated $101M. The largest seller was Kayne Anderson Rudnick Investment Management, cutting an estimated $27.6M.
